> +/**
> + * inv_icm42607_irq_init() - initialize int pin and interrupt handler
> + * @st: driver internal state
> + * @irq: irq number
> + * @irq_type: irq trigger type
> + * @open_drain: true if irq is open drain, false for push-pull
> + *
> + * Returns 0 on success, a negative error code otherwise.
> + */
> +static int inv_icm42607_irq_init(struct inv_icm42607_state *st, int irq,
> + int irq_type, bool open_drain)
> +{
> + struct device *dev = regmap_get_device(st->map);
> + unsigned int val = 0;
> + int ret;
> +
> + switch (irq_type) {
> + case IRQF_TRIGGER_RISING:
> + case IRQF_TRIGGER_HIGH:
> + val = INV_ICM42607_INT_CONFIG_INT1_ACTIVE_HIGH;
> + break;
> + default:
> + val = INV_ICM42607_INT_CONFIG_INT1_ACTIVE_LOW;
> + break;
> + }
> +
> + switch (irq_type) {
> + case IRQF_TRIGGER_LOW:
> + case IRQF_TRIGGER_HIGH:
> + val |= INV_ICM42607_INT_CONFIG_INT1_LATCHED;
> + break;
> + default:
> + break;
> + }
> +
> + if (!open_drain)
> + val |= INV_ICM42607_INT_CONFIG_INT1_PUSH_PULL;
> +
> + ret = regmap_write(st->map, INV_ICM42607_REG_INT_CONFIG, val);
> + if (ret)
> + return ret;
> +
> + irq_type |= IRQF_ONESHOT;
> + return devm_request_threaded_irq(dev, irq, inv_icm42607_irq_timestamp,
> + inv_icm42607_irq_handler, irq_type,
> + st->name, st);
> +}
